Fall detection system using a combination of accelerometer, audio input and magnetometer

1. An apparatus comprising:
- an accelerometer to measure an acceleration of a user;
a magnetometer to measure a magnetic field associated with the user and to calculate an orientation of the user based on a measured magnetic field;
a microphone to receive audio;
a memory to store the audio; and
a processing device communicatively connected to the accelerometer, the magnetometer, the microphone, and the memory, the processing device to;
identify an occurrence of a suspected fall event based on a measured acceleration provided by the accelerometer and a change of orientation of the user provided at least in part by the magnetometer; and
confirm the suspected fall event as a fall event based on the stored audio.

Abstract
A wearable device for detecting a user state is disclosed. The wearable device includes an accelerometer for measuring an acceleration of a user, a magnetometer for measuring a magnetic field associated with the user'"'"'s change of orientation, a microphone for receiving audio, a memory for storing the audio, and at least one processor communicatively connected to the accelerometer, the magnetometer, the microphone, and the memory. The processor is identified to declare a measured acceleration as a suspected user state, and to categorize the suspected user state based on the stored audio as one of an activity of daily life (ADL), a confirmed user state, or an inconclusive event.
